Quick Tips To Help Deal With Water Damage
Water provides life, water breach on parts where it's not expected to be can result in damage. Homes with water damages smell old as well as stuffy.

Water can come from numerous sources such as hurricanes, floodings, ruptured pipelines, leakages, as well as drain issues. In case you experience water damages, it would certainly be excellent to understand some safety and security preventative measures. Below are a couple of guidelines on how to take care of water damages.

Do Prioritize Residence Insurance Policy Insurance Coverage



Water damage from flood because of hefty winds is seasonal. You can likewise experience an unexpected flood when a faulty pipeline instantly breaks right into your home. It would be best to have residence insurance policy that covers both disasters such as natural tragedies, as well as emergency situations like broken plumbing.

Don't Neglect to Switch Off Energies



This cuts off power to your whole home, stopping electrical shocks when water comes in as it is a conductor. Do not neglect to turn off the major water line valve.

Do Stay Proactive and Heed Weather Alerts



Pay attention to emptying warnings if you live near a lake, creek, or river . Doing so lowers possible residential property damages.

Do Not Overlook the Roof



You can stay clear of rainfall damage if there are no openings and leaks in your roof. This will prevent water from streaming down your wall surfaces and soaking your ceiling.

Do Focus On Small Leaks



A burst pipeline doesn't take place over night. Normally, there are red flags that indicate you have actually weakened pipelines in your home. You might discover bubbling paint, peeling wallpaper, water touches, water discolorations, or dripping audios behind the walls. Ultimately, this pipe will certainly burst. Preferably, you must not wait on things to intensify. Have your plumbing repaired before it results in massive damage.

Don't Panic in Case of a Burst Pipeline



When it comes to water damages, timing is crucial. Hence, if a pipeline ruptureds in your house, quickly shut off your main water valve to reduce off the source. Call a reliable water damages repair expert for help.

Water Damage Do and Don'ts


Water damage at your home or commercial property is a serious problem. You will need assistance from a professional plumber and a water damage restoration agency to get things back in order. While you are waiting for help to arrive, however, there are some things you should do to make the situation better. Likewise, there are things you absolutely shoud not do because they will only make things worse.




DO these things to improve your situation


Get some ventilation going. Open up your doors, your windows, your cabinets – everything. Don’t let anything remain closed. Your aim here is to expose as much surface area to air as possible in order to quicken the drying out process. Use fans if you have them, but only if they’re plugged into a part of the house that’s not currently underwater.


Remove as much standing water as you can. Do this by using mops, sponges and clean white towels. However, it’s important that you don’t push or wipe the water. Simply use blotting motions to soak it up. Wiping or pushing could result in the water getting pushed deeper into your home or carpeting and increasing your problem.


Turn off the power to the soaked areas. You will want to remove the danger of electrocution from the water-logged area to do some cleaning and to help the plumber and the restoration agents do their work.



Move any furniture and belongings from the affected room to a safe and dry area. Taking your possessions to a dry place will make it easier to decide which need restoring and repair. It will also prevent your belongings from being exposed to further moisture.


DON’T do any of these things for any reason


Don’t use your vacuum cleaner to suck up the water. This will not only get you electrocuted, but will also severely damage your vacuum cleaner. Use manual means of water removal, like with mops and pails.



Don’t use newspaper to soak up the water. The ink they use for newsprint runs and transfers very easily, which could then stain carpet and tile with hard-to-remove stains.



Don’t disturb mold. This is especially true if you spot a severe growth. Leave the mold remediation efforts to the professionals. Attempting to clean it yourself could mean exposing yourself to the harmful health effects of mold. Worse, you could inadvertently spread it to other areas of the house.



Don’t turn on your HVAC system until given approval from the restoration agency. Turning your HVAC system on before everything has been cleaned could spread moisture and mold all over the house.
